Rapid Recap: Grizzlies 125, Bucks 104

The Milwaukee Bucks fall to the Memphis Grizzlies 125-104, unable to win consecutive games since they did so in the early season. AJ Green was probably the Bucks’ best player with a season-high-tying 20 points on 6/11 from three. Jaren Jackson Jr. led the Grizzlies with 24 points, nine rebounds, and five blocks. Wizards at Grizzlies final score: Washington upsets Memphis, 130-122

The Washington Wizards upset the Memphis Grizzlies on Saturday night with a 130-122 win The Wizards took advantage of a monster third quarter to get a win that most didn’t expect. Washington shot 62.5 percent from the field with Kyshawn George scoring 13 of his 28 points in that period alone. Washington also took advantage […]
